Can't say I've ever had a drive lock on me so not sure if this would work but my usual method is to boot from a live usb (or cd) with something like ubuntu then move the files to an external drive and scan the drive on a separate computer just do a scan from inside ubuntu on the infected machine if you don't want to transfer files around.
